Soil creep refers to the process whereby soil and sediments on a hillside begin to flow down the hill gradually. It is quite prevalent in humid areas with lots of rain.
The North Carolina mountains provide conditions necessary for soil creep to occur as they are both humid areas with high amounts of rainfall and comprise of various hills that soil and sediments can flow downwards on.

When an aircraft is flying in a region of warm air, the altitude is higher than the one the altimeter indicates. On the other hand, when the air is cold, the actual altitude is lower.
Given these facts, if the aircraft flies from warm to cold air, the altimeter will read too high, when in fact, the altitude will be lower. Conversely, if the aircraft flies from cold to warm air, the altimeter will read too low, when in fact, the altitude is higher.
